Multiply 42/7 with 10/8

1st number: 6 0/7, 2nd number: 1 2/8

This multiplication involving fractions can also be rephrased as "What is 42/7 of 1 2/8?"

42/7 × 10/8 is 15/2.

Steps for multiplying fractions

  1. Simply multiply the numerators and denominators separately:
  2. 42/7 × 10/8 = 42 × 10/7 × 8 = 420/56
  3. After reducing the fraction, the answer is 15/2
